米国のポイントオブエントリーPFAS処理システム市場サマリー

米国のポイントオブエントリーPFAS処理システム市場規模は、2024年に4,080万米ドルと推計され、2033年には5,710万米ドルに達し、2025年から2033年までのCAGRは3.8%で成長すると予測されています。市場は、水中に含まれる複数のPFAS化合物に対して厳しい規制値を設定するEPA規制が新たに導入されたことにより、強く牽引されています。これらの規制は、影響を受ける水源を監視、報告、処理することを公益事業者に義務付けており、認証POEシステムに対する投資の増加を促しています。

同市場は、ますます厳しくなる規制と、工業用水や自治体用水におけるパーフルオロアルキル物質(PFAS)やポリフルオロアルキル物質(PFAS)の汚染に対処すべきとの社会的圧力の高まりによって、力強い成長を遂げています。PFASは消火用フォーム、化学薬品製造、さまざまな工業プロセスで広く使用されてきたが、環境中に残留することから、EPAを含む連邦および州レベルの規制機関にとって優先事項となっています。

その結果、化学工場、金属仕上げ業者、繊維製造業者などの産業施設は、排出制限の遵守と下流の水源保護のために、専用のPOE処理システムに投資しています。

U.S. Point of Entry PFAS Treatment Systems Market Summary

The U.S. point of entry PFAS treatment systems market size was estimated at USD 40.8 million in 2024 and is projected to reach USD 57.1 million by 2033, growing at a CAGR of 3.8% from 2025 to 2033. The market is being strongly driven by newly implemented EPA regulations that set strict limits for multiple PFAS compounds in water. These rules require utilities to monitor, report, and treat affected water sources, prompting increased investment in certified POE systems.

The market is experiencing robust growth, driven by increasingly stringent regulations and rising public pressure to address per- and polyfluoroalkyl substances (PFAS) contamination in industrial and municipal water supplies. While PFAS have been widely used in firefighting foams, chemical manufacturing, and various industrial processes, their persistence in the environment has made them a priority for federal and state-level regulatory agencies, including the EPA.

As a result, industrial facilities such as chemical plants, metal finishers, and textile manufacturers are investing in dedicated POE treatment systems to ensure compliance with discharge limits and protect downstream water sources.
